Follow The Directions

01

Step
10 mins

Bring a large pot of salted water to a rolling boil. Add the macaroni and cook until al dente, about 8-10 minutes. Drain well and set aside. (Time: 8-10 minutes)

02

Step
7 mins

While the pasta is cooking, mel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the chopped green bell pepper and onion.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ables are tender, about 5-7 minutes. (Time: 5-7 minutes)

03

Step
5 mins

Stir in the chili with beans, drained corn, salt, and pepper. Reduce heat to low and simmer for 5 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ld. (Time: 5 minutes)

04

Step
5 mins

Add the cooked and drained macaroni to the skillet. Stir to combine, ensuring the pasta is well coated with the sauce. Cover and cook on low heat for another 5 minutes to heat through. (Time: 5 minutes)

05

Step

Serve warm and enjoy!

For a richer flavor, try using a chili with beef or a spicier variety.
Feel free to add other vegetables like diced tomatoes, zucchini, or mushrooms.
A sprinkle of shredded cheese, such as cheddar or Monterey Jack, makes a delicious topping.
This pasta dish can be easily customized to your liking. Get creative with your favorite spices and ingredients!
